NEED ANSWERS?

Frequently Asked Questions

Singularity AI Data Pipelines are an AI-powered data optimization layer built into the SentinelOne Singularity Platform. They filter, normalize, and enrich security telemetry before it reaches your SIEM, reducing data volume by up to 80% while improving detection and investigation quality.

By using AI to identify and remove repetitive, low-value telemetry before ingestion, AI Data Pipelines significantly reduce the volume of data your SIEM processes and stores. Less data volume translates directly to lower ingest and storage costs.

Yes. AI Data Pipelines provide a migration path that works with your existing collectors, avoids pipeline rewrites, and normalizes data into standardized schemas. This accelerates the transition to AI SIEM without requiring your team to start from scratch.

AI Data Pipelines normalize telemetry into OCSF and other industry-standard schemas. AI-driven Grok pattern generation and out-of-the-box transforms support a wide range of data sources and formats.

AI Data Pipelines are built natively into the Singularity Platform. Filtered and enriched data flows directly into AI SIEM and Singularity Data Lake, and the cleaner inputs improve the accuracy of Purple AI queries and automated investigations.
